On The Run Store Brentwood - Hours & Locations
On The Run Store - Brentwood
2120 S Brentwood Blvd, Brentwood MO 63144Hours may fluctuate
Distance:0.30 miles
On The Run Store - St Louis
9950 Big Bend Blvd, St Louis MO 63122Hours may fluctuate
Distance:4.11 miles
On The Run Store - Overland
9403 Page Ave, Overland MO 63114Hours may fluctuate
Distance:4.90 miles
On The Run Store - Charlack
8566 St Charles Rock Rd, Charlack MO 63114Hours may fluctuate
Distance:6.12 miles
On The Run Store - Valley Park
1266 Dougherty Ferry, Valley Park MO 63088Hours may fluctuate
Distance:7.70 miles
On The Run Store - Fenton
1000 Bowles Ave, Fenton MO 63026Hours may fluctuate
Distance:9.30 miles
On The Run Store - Valley Park
280 Vance Rd, Valley Park MO 63088Hours may fluctuate
Distance:9.59 miles
On The Run Store - St Louis
4450 Meramec Bottom Rd, St Louis MO 63129Hours may fluctuate
Distance:10.91 miles
On The Run Store - Maryland Heights
13553 Riverport Dr, Maryland Heights MO 63043Hours may fluctuate
Distance:11.02 miles
On The Run Store - Chesterfield
1789 Clarkson Rd, Chesterfield MO 63017Hours may fluctuate
Distance:11.95 miles